When we say a gene is expressing itself, what does “gene expression” mean in relation to protein synthesis?

          Gene expression, as it relates to protein synthesis, manifests itself through the translation of genes into proteins. It consists of two stages: transcription, or the replication of specific DNA to create a particular molecule of RNA, and translation, or the conversion of RNA into the appropriate sequence of amino acids to build proteins. Consequently, it is evident that gene expression also results in the generation of proteins, suggesting that gene expression and protein synthesis may be seen as related processes.
